Housing Stock in Bielski County 2018
In 2018, Bielski county ranked 291 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 562 units +2.41% between 2013-2018, at 23,902.
Among 41 growing counties, in bottom 10% for housing growth rate. Within Podlaskie province, ranked 8 of 17 counties.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Bielski county and its 8 municipalities within Podlaskie province.
